NSS12201LT1G Product Details

NSS12201LT1G Description


The ON Semiconductor NSS12201LT1G is a 12 V, 4.0 A, Low VCE(sat) NPN Transistor.



NSS12201LT1G Features


  • High Current, Low VCE(sat), ESD Robust, High Current Gain, High Cut Off Frequency, Low Profile Package, Linear Gain (Beta)

  • Improved Circuit Efficiency, Decreased Battery Charge Time, Reduced component count, High-Frequency Switching, Smaller Portable Product, No distortion



NSS12201LT1G Applications


Load Switching

Battery Charging

External Pass Transistor

DC/DC Converter

Complimentary Driver

Current Extention & Low Drop-Out Regulation

Cathode Florescent Lamp drive

Peripheral Driver - LEDs

Motors

Relays
